In the US, the eating style is very attentive, this is also something that many Asians in general when American tourism easily make mistakes. Americans sitting at the table will sit up straight, politely put their hands on the table. They used a spoon to bring food into their mouths, not putting the dishes in their mouths.

No sound when eating. They do not let the dishes touch or chew, even when using Asian dishes. Americans who are taught from babies when they have to eat and drink have to close their mouths to prevent others from seeing food in their mouths, open-mouthed eating is considered rude and this is also what many tourists come to America for the first time. error.

In particular, reduce the phone volume when you eat at restaurants, restaurants. It’s quite impolite if you’re having a meal and the phone rings loudly. Besides, if you need to listen to the phone, apologize and ask the person to sit at the table and take the phone off the table, avoid casually listening to the phone at the table because the person sitting at the table will feel disrespectful important.

When going to a party at home, you need to prepare a dish to bring along to contribute. If the landlord opens a party without the need to bring anything, you should bring a bottle of wine, a bouquet of flowers or a small gift to show courtesy and appreciation.

For parties with waiters and sitting with many people, note that Americans do not share dishes or spoons with anyone. Each guest has a separate bowl of dipping sauce, each with its own set of food, each person will take their own part when eating, remember to wait for the turn.
